A 32-year-old man with progressive bilateral hearing loss has Rinne negative in both ears and Weber central. When the external auditory canal is occluded with a finger during bone-conduction testing with a 512 Hz fork, he reports NO change in loudness (negative Bing test). This finding supports:
- A Normal hearing
- B Sensorineural hearing loss
- C Otitis media with effusion
- D Fixation of the stapes footplate ✓
Explanation
The Bing test relies on the occlusion effect: closing a normal mobile ear canal traps bone-conducted sound and makes it louder (positive Bing) in normal hearing and sensorineural loss. When the stapes footplate is fixed, as in otosclerosis, the occlusion effect is abolished and the test is negative. Combined with a negative Rinne and central Weber, the negative Bing confirms bilateral conductive loss from stapes fixation rather than effusion, which usually gives variable results.
